About The Position

McKay Métis Contracting is seeking an experienced Journeyperson Heavy Equipment Technician at our client site at Fort Hills. The Heavy Equipment Technician is accountable for diagnosing, servicing, and repairing various systems on heavy equipment and trucks, including mechanical and computer electronic controls, air brake systems, and transmissions. This role involves troubleshooting malfunctions, performing routine maintenance, overhauling engines, and maintaining service logs.

Responsibilities

  • Diagnose, service, and repair various systems that are found on heavy equipment and trucks such as mechanical and computer electronic controls, air brake systems, transmissions, computer controlled automatic and 13 speed manual transmissions.
  • Troubleshoot malfunctions in the equipment and perform repairs.
  • Repair and service track drive sprockets, rails, idler wheels, hard bars, track adjusters, hydraulic reversals, final drives, brake bands, steering clutches, and hydrostatic transmissions.
  • Perform routine maintenance checks and adjustments on such things as fluid levels, hoses, belts, brakes, tires, and clutches; change filters and oil, and lubricate vehicles and motor driven equipment.
  • Service, diagnose, repair and maintain speed tandem axel with air or electric shift, hydrostatic driven, heavy duty multi-axel suspensions, both conventional steel or air springs.
  • Overhaul engines, replace engines, and rebuild components.
  • Maintain service logs and records of maintenance on all heavy-duty trucks and heavy equipment.
  • Prepare work orders and cost material estimates.
  • Test mechanical products and equipment after repair or assembly to ensure proper performance and compliance with manufacturers' specifications.
  • Diagnose faults or malfunctions to determine required repairs, using engine diagnostic equipment such as computerized test equipment and calibration devices.
  • Assemble gear systems and align frames and gears.
  • Adjust and maintain industrial machinery, using control and regulating devices.
  • Schedule maintenance for industrial machines and equipment and keep equipment service records.
